Sec. 1302.504. APPLICATION; FEE.
(a)An applicant for an air conditioning and refrigeration technician registration or certification must submit a verified application on a form prescribed by the executive director.
(b)The completed application must be accompanied by the required fees.

Legislative History
Added by Acts 2007, 80th Leg., R.S., Ch. 1174 (H.B. 463 ), Sec. 6, eff. September 1, 2007.
Amended by:
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 1017 (H.B. 2643 ), Sec. 20, eff. June 17, 2011.
Acts 2017, 85th Leg., R.S., Ch. 880 (H.B. 3029 ), Sec. 13, eff. September 1, 2017.
